technomadic cyberanthropologist, free culture advocate, linguistic alchemystic, open source muse.
i hack culture, language, people - not as a social engineer but more of a gonzo anthropologist. i am interested in new forms of storytelling using technology. i believe nature is the first and still most mysterious technology. principally, i am dedicated to hybridizing the hacker/maker, eco/communitarian/permaculturalist and psychedelic cultures so as to reboot society through peer-to-peer communication and the integration of nature and technology.
you can find me as 'tunabananas' on irc, and the internet more generally. writings can be found [1].
current projects
- Wikitown - Eudea is a wikitown that aspires to help form an open source appropriate technology ecovillage: a technecovillage. A testing ground for biomimetic design and fabrication, unified by pursuits of social and biological benefit, developing decentralization, automation and accessibility.
- Sudo Room - Establishing a hackerspace in downtown Oakland devoted to, among other things, free education, citizen science, digital literacy, environmental sustainability and self-governance.
- The Pyre - Civilization has crumbled, and everywhere all things are burning. You have a multi-tool, a tiny laptop, and a 32GB USB stick. What's on the stick?
